Home
last modified time | relevance | path

Searched refs:SkPDFDocument (Results 1 – 25 of 60) sorted by relevance

123

/external/skqp/src/pdf/
DSkPDFDocument.cpp117 SkPDFDocument* doc, in generate_page_tree()
133 static std::vector<PageTreeNode> Layer(std::vector<PageTreeNode> vec, SkPDFDocument* doc) { in generate_page_tree()
188 SkPDFDocument::SkPDFDocument(SkWStream* stream, in SkPDFDocument() function in SkPDFDocument
203 SkPDFDocument::~SkPDFDocument() { in ~SkPDFDocument()
208 SkPDFIndirectReference SkPDFDocument::emit(const SkPDFObject& object, SkPDFIndirectReference ref){ in emit()
214 SkWStream* SkPDFDocument::beginObject(SkPDFIndirectReference ref) { in beginObject()
220 void SkPDFDocument::endObject() { in endObject()
228 SkCanvas* SkPDFDocument::onBeginPage(SkScalar width, SkScalar height) { in onBeginPage()
266 void SkPDFDocument::onEndPage() { in onEndPage()
295 void SkPDFDocument::onAbort() { in onAbort()
[all …]
DSkPDFFont.h86 static SkPDFFont* GetFontResource(SkPDFDocument* doc,
96 SkPDFDocument* canon);
99 SkPDFDocument* canon);
101 void emitSubset(SkPDFDocument*) const;
107 static bool CanEmbedTypeface(SkTypeface*, SkPDFDocument*);
DSkPDFBitmap.h11 class SkPDFDocument; variable
19 SkPDFDocument* doc,
DSkPDFFormXObject.h15 class SkPDFDocument; variable
22 SkPDFIndirectReference SkPDFMakeFormXObject(SkPDFDocument* doc,
DSkPDFTag.h16 class SkPDFDocument; variable
26 SkPDFIndirectReference makeStructTreeRoot(SkPDFDocument* doc);
DSkPDFBitmap.cpp69 static void emit_image_stream(SkPDFDocument* doc, in emit_image_stream()
101 static void do_deflated_alpha(const SkPixmap& pm, SkPDFDocument* doc, SkPDFIndirectReference ref) { in do_deflated_alpha()
138 SkPDFDocument* doc, in do_deflated_image()
196 static bool do_jpeg(sk_sp<SkData> data, SkPDFDocument* doc, SkISize size, in do_jpeg()
250 SkPDFDocument* doc, in serialize_image()
273 SkPDFDocument* doc, in SkPDFSerializeImage()
DSkPDFGraphicState.h32 SkPDFIndirectReference GetGraphicStateForPaint(SkPDFDocument*, const SkPaint&);
44 SkPDFDocument* doc);
DSkPDFDocumentPriv.h53 class SkPDFDocument : public SkDocument {
55 SkPDFDocument(SkWStream*, SkPDF::Metadata);
56 ~SkPDFDocument() override;
DSkPDFShader.h18 class SkPDFDocument; variable
41 SkPDFIndirectReference SkPDFMakeShader(SkPDFDocument* doc,
DSkPDFGraphicState.cpp56 SkPDFIndirectReference SkPDFGraphicState::GetGraphicStateForPaint(SkPDFDocument* doc, in GetGraphicStateForPaint()
103 static SkPDFIndirectReference make_invert_function(SkPDFDocument* doc) { in make_invert_function()
120 SkPDFDocument* doc) { in GetSMaskGraphicState()
DSkPDFFont.cpp108 SkPDFDocument* canon) { in GetMetrics()
158 SkPDFDocument* canon) { in GetUnicodeMap()
188 SkPDFFont* SkPDFFont::GetFontResource(SkPDFDocument* doc, in GetFontResource()
288 static void emit_subset_type0(const SkPDFFont& font, SkPDFDocument* doc) { in emit_subset_type0()
419 static SkPDFIndirectReference make_type1_font_descriptor(SkPDFDocument* doc, in make_type1_font_descriptor()
449 static const std::vector<SkString>& type_1_glyphnames(SkPDFDocument* canon, in type_1_glyphnames()
462 static SkPDFIndirectReference type1_font_descriptor(SkPDFDocument* doc, in type1_font_descriptor()
474 static void emit_subset_type1(const SkPDFFont& pdfFont, SkPDFDocument* doc) { in emit_subset_type1()
605 static SkPDFIndirectReference type3_descriptor(SkPDFDocument* doc, in type3_descriptor()
635 static void emit_subset_type3(const SkPDFFont& pdfFont, SkPDFDocument* doc) { in emit_subset_type3()
[all …]
DSkPDFGradientShader.h15 class SkPDFDocument; variable
20 SkPDFIndirectReference Make(SkPDFDocument* doc,
/external/skia/src/pdf/
DSkPDFDocument.cpp116 SkPDFDocument* doc, in generate_page_tree()
132 static std::vector<PageTreeNode> Layer(std::vector<PageTreeNode> vec, SkPDFDocument* doc) { in generate_page_tree()
187 SkPDFDocument::SkPDFDocument(SkWStream* stream, in SkPDFDocument() function in SkPDFDocument
202 SkPDFDocument::~SkPDFDocument() { in ~SkPDFDocument()
207 SkPDFIndirectReference SkPDFDocument::emit(const SkPDFObject& object, SkPDFIndirectReference ref){ in emit()
214 SkWStream* SkPDFDocument::beginObject(SkPDFIndirectReference ref) SK_REQUIRES(fMutex) { in beginObject()
219 void SkPDFDocument::endObject() SK_REQUIRES(fMutex) { in endObject()
226 SkCanvas* SkPDFDocument::onBeginPage(SkScalar width, SkScalar height) { in onBeginPage()
279 SkPDFDocument* doc, in get_annotations()
309 SkPDFDocument* doc, in append_destinations()
[all …]
DSkPDFFont.h20 class SkPDFDocument; variable
90 static SkPDFFont* GetFontResource(SkPDFDocument* doc,
99 SkPDFDocument* canon);
102 SkPDFDocument* canon);
109 void emitSubset(SkPDFDocument*) const;
115 static bool CanEmbedTypeface(SkTypeface*, SkPDFDocument*);
DSkPDFBitmap.h11 class SkPDFDocument; variable
19 SkPDFDocument* doc,
DSkPDFFormXObject.h15 class SkPDFDocument; variable
22 SkPDFIndirectReference SkPDFMakeFormXObject(SkPDFDocument* doc,
DSkPDFTag.h16 class SkPDFDocument; variable
27 SkPDFIndirectReference makeStructTreeRoot(SkPDFDocument* doc);
DSkPDFBitmap.cpp69 static void emit_image_stream(SkPDFDocument* doc, in emit_image_stream()
101 static void do_deflated_alpha(const SkPixmap& pm, SkPDFDocument* doc, SkPDFIndirectReference ref) { in do_deflated_alpha()
138 SkPDFDocument* doc, in do_deflated_image()
196 static bool do_jpeg(sk_sp<SkData> data, SkPDFDocument* doc, SkISize size, in do_jpeg()
250 SkPDFDocument* doc, in serialize_image()
273 SkPDFDocument* doc, in SkPDFSerializeImage()
DSkPDFShader.h18 class SkPDFDocument; variable
41 SkPDFIndirectReference SkPDFMakeShader(SkPDFDocument* doc,
DSkPDFGraphicState.h32 SkPDFIndirectReference GetGraphicStateForPaint(SkPDFDocument*, const SkPaint&);
44 SkPDFDocument* doc);
DSkPDFGraphicState.cpp56 SkPDFIndirectReference SkPDFGraphicState::GetGraphicStateForPaint(SkPDFDocument* doc, in GetGraphicStateForPaint()
103 static SkPDFIndirectReference make_invert_function(SkPDFDocument* doc) { in make_invert_function()
120 SkPDFDocument* doc) { in GetSMaskGraphicState()
DSkPDFDocumentPriv.h60 class SkPDFDocument : public SkDocument {
62 SkPDFDocument(SkWStream*, SkPDF::Metadata);
63 ~SkPDFDocument() override;
DSkPDFDevice.h33 class SkPDFDocument; variable
58 SkPDFDevice(SkISize pageSize, SkPDFDocument* document,
140 SkPDFDocument* fDocument;
/external/skia/bench/
DPDFBench.cpp111 SkPDFDocument doc(&nullStream, SkPDF::Metadata()); in onDraw()
146 SkPDFDocument doc(&nullStream, SkPDF::Metadata()); in onDraw()
176 SkPDFDocument doc(&wStream, SkPDF::Metadata()); in onDraw()
219 SkPDFDocument doc(&nullStream, SkPDF::Metadata()); in onDraw()
293 SkPDFDocument doc(&wStream, SkPDF::Metadata()); in onDraw()
/external/skqp/bench/
DPDFBench.cpp111 SkPDFDocument doc(&nullStream, SkPDF::Metadata()); in onDraw()
146 SkPDFDocument doc(&nullStream, SkPDF::Metadata()); in onDraw()
176 SkPDFDocument doc(&wStream, SkPDF::Metadata()); in onDraw()
219 SkPDFDocument doc(&nullStream, SkPDF::Metadata()); in onDraw()

123